Virginia Judiciary E-Filing System (VJEFS)

The Virginia Judiciary E-Filing System (VJEFS) is a comprehensive e-filing system developed by the Office of the Executive Secretary of the Supreme Court of Virginia, to integrate the circuit court clerks’ offices’ existing statewide Circuit Case Management, Case Imaging, and Financial Management Systems, thereby improving the efficiency of clerks’ offices.

There is no fee for this service. Initial filings of civil cases by paper will be charged an additional $5.00 fee. The additional $5.00 fee is not charged for e-filings.

Instructions for E-Filing

*Beginning July 15, 2013 (accepting applications now)

  1. Fill out the application (PDF) and return to the Clerk's Office by email or fax.
  2. Once the application is received the Clerk's Office will set you up with a login.
  3. Log in online and begin filing in civil cases. The case must be initiated in VJEFS in order to file subsequent filings. If it is not initiated using VJEFS you must send in the paper filings.
